FUELLAS, ROMMEL T. Swine Production at Calumpang Cerca, Indang, Cavite: An Entrepreneurial Development Project. Bachelor in Agricultural Entrepreneurship major in Animal Production. College of Agriculture, Food, Environment and Natural Resources, Department of Animal Science. Cavite State University, Indang, Cavite. June 2018: Dr. Mariedel L. Autriz.
The entrepreneurial project was conducted at Calumpang Cerca, Indang, Cavite from December 31, 2017 to April 22, 2018. This entrepreneurial project aimed to expose the student to actual activities in the field of animal production, apply all the knowledge and skills they learned from various subjects taken and gain profit from hog raising.
The average initial weigh of 4 piglets was 10.25 kg and the feed consumption of 4 hogs was 650 kg. The total production cost was ₱33,778.00 with the gross sales of ₱36,376.00 has a net income of ₱2,598.00. The return investment was 7.69%.
In the 114 days of raising hogs, the entrepreneurial project helped the student to expose and do different activities in the field of animal production and by solving the different problems encountered in doing this kind of entrepreneurial project. Also, the student entrepreneur applied all the knowledge and skills by proper care and management of hogs, by correct ways of injecting in intramuscular part behind of the base of the ear of the hog that they learned from various subjects taken.
